Neutral mutations have no effect on organism and the majority of mutations are neutral


Harmful mutations (or deleterious) may cause genetic disorders and those mutation decreases the fitness of the organism.


Beneficial mutations (or advantageous)  increases the fitness of the organism and may become more common through natural selection.

Why is the term "food web" more appropriate than "food chain" in referring to the energy relationships among the species of a co
BaLLatris [955]
Food web is more appropriate because of how wide spread the animal kingdom is, there are many predators for many different animals. For example, if a rabbit is killed by a wolf and the wolf eats a part of the carcass and leaves it, soon other scavengers will come and eat the remains, which then spans out into a web of animals, which allows us more data than what a chain may give us to visualize.
